Struggling telecoms equipment supplier Newbridge Networks has admitted that it is in talks with French telecoms giant, Alcatel. Acquisition speculation has been growing steadily since 2 November, when Newbridge announced that its second quarter revenues and profits would be below analysts' expectations.
